Facebook не работает в localhost

Мне нужно интегрировать вход в Facebook на моем веб-сайте. Я добавил localhost.com, localhost в настройку доменов приложений в приложении facebook, а также установил https: // localhost / mysocial / socialmedia / логин / Facebook в действительных URI перенаправления OAuth. Я получил следующую ошибку.

Can't Load URL: The domain of this URL isn't included in the app's domains. To be able to load this URL, add all domains and subdomains of your app to the App Domains field in your app settings.

Как исправить.

Сони, тебе стоит попробовать ответ @GhostfromTexas. Он прав.

Himanshu Upadhyay 31.05.2018 08:20
Стоит ли изучать PHP в 2026-2027 годах?
Стоит ли изучать PHP в 2026-2027 годах?
Привет всем, сегодня я хочу высказать свои соображения по поводу вопроса, который я уже много раз получал в своем сообществе: "Стоит ли изучать PHP в...
Symfony Station Communiqué - 7 июля 2023 г
Symfony Station Communiqué - 7 июля 2023 г
Это коммюнике первоначально появилось на Symfony Station .
Оживление вашего приложения Laravel: Понимание режима обслуживания
Оживление вашего приложения Laravel: Понимание режима обслуживания
Здравствуйте, разработчики! В сегодняшней статье мы рассмотрим важный аспект управления приложениями, который часто упускается из виду в суете...
Установка и настройка Nginx и PHP на Ubuntu-сервере
Установка и настройка Nginx и PHP на Ubuntu-сервере
В этот раз я сделаю руководство по установке и настройке nginx и php на Ubuntu OS.
Коллекции в Laravel более простым способом
Коллекции в Laravel более простым способом
Привет, читатели, сегодня мы узнаем о коллекциях. В Laravel коллекции - это способ манипулировать массивами и играть с массивами данных. Благодаря...
Как установить PHP на Mac
Как установить PHP на Mac
PHP - это популярный язык программирования, который используется для разработки веб-приложений. Если вы используете Mac и хотите разрабатывать...
0
1
380
1

Ответы 1

"localhost.com" ничего вам не даст.

Вам нужен полный URL-адрес для обратного вызова с вашим oauth. Обычно с Oauth у вас будет что-то вроде ...

mydomain.com/auth/facebook/callback

Это настройка конечной точки для обработки обратного вызова из Facebook или других сайтов обратно в ваше приложение после завершения авторизации. Это должен быть ваш URL-адрес перенаправления в настройках вашего приложения на Facebook.

Я специально написал нашу систему OAuth там, где я работаю, и мы интегрировали Facebook, так что я прошел именно через это.

Это наши настройки для перенаправления локального хоста:

https://i.gyazo.com/c67a3043c4b397f78d5a77295a0f8a9d.png

Удачи!

Я изменил свои действительные URI перенаправления OAuth на «127.0.0.1:8080/idashboard/socialmedia/login/Facebook».

soni soniya 31.05.2018 15:04

URL заблокирован: это перенаправление не удалось, потому что URI перенаправления не внесен в белый список в настройках клиента OAuth приложения. Убедитесь, что клиент и веб-вход OAuth включены, и добавьте все свои домены приложений в качестве действительных URI перенаправления OAuth.

soni soniya 31.05.2018 15:04

https запрос нужен на сайте, меняют только в прошлом марте

GGw 01.06.2018 08:01

Другие вопросы по теме